Output 0856043424325338803e4bc3e1bf6a03370e8e94a5bde7ead77ea89e67fbc251:76

value
188751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89c2bd216b7da0b12155729641ffabf7633b8e2e OP_EQUAL
address
3EFRnWhnucietkKAYXMuC44sbCugeY2hdi
transaction
0856043424325338803e4bc3e1bf6a03370e8e94a5bde7ead77ea89e67fbc251
spent
true